Where each one falls short

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.

Doximity

  • Free tier limited to verified US clinicians only; no international access without premium
  • AI Scribe and Dialer features accessible only to US-based healthcare professionals
  • Premium tier pricing not disclosed on main site

Practice Fusion

  • Cloud-based architecture requires constant internet connectivity
  • Requires annual commitment for pricing

Answered from the vendors’ own pages

Doximity: Is Doximity free?

Doximity is free for verified US clinicians. Specific subscription tiers and paid plan pricing are not disclosed on their website.

Source
Practice Fusion: How much does Practice Fusion cost?

Practice Fusion starts at $199 per month per provider with an annual commitment required. The pricing includes 3 signing staff licenses and unlimited non-signing staff licenses.

Source
Practice Fusion: Does Practice Fusion offer a free trial?

Yes, Practice Fusion offers a complimentary 2-week trial with no commitment, no upfront costs, and no credit card required.
